The 2025 Leagues Cup, the third edition of the tournament, begins on July 29th and concludes on August 31st. It features head-to-head competition between Liga MX and Major League Soccer (MLS) to crown a North American champion.
Teams compete for a trophy, prize money, bragging rights between the leagues, and qualification spots. The winner secures three spots for their league in the 2026 CONCACAF Champions Cup. Additionally, the champion earns the right to represent the CONCACAF region in future FIFA international club competitions.
The tournament includes 36 teams: 18 from MLS and 18 from Liga MX. Matches will be played concurrently with both leagues' regular seasons during August. The MLS participants are the top nine teams from each conference (all 2024 playoff teams), with expansion side San Diego FC replacing Vancouver Whitecaps due to Vancouver's Champions Cup participation. Liga MX is represented by its entire 18-team league.
MLS currently holds a 2-0 lead in the tournament's history, with Inter Miami winning the inaugural edition and Columbus Crew winning the 2024 title.
